IMPALA and CMU Announce Digital Forward Webinar on Campaign Effectiveness

IMPALA and CMU’s Digital Forward series continues with a webinar on measuring marketing campaign effectiveness for independent labels on 30 June.

The next Digital Forward webinar, presented by IMPALA and CMU, will take place on 30 June at 14:00 CET, focusing on campaign effectiveness, measurement and reporting for independent record labels.

Led by CMU’s Sam Taylor, the session is the third instalment of a guidance series on digital marketing. It will examine best practices for using data to monitor marketing effectiveness and how labels can distinguish meaningful metrics from noise. Expert speakers will contribute insights, and a written report summarising key findings will follow the event.

Earlier parts of the series addressed off-platform and on-platform marketing strategies, as well as campaign planning and execution.

IMPALA was founded in 2000 and now represents over 6,000 independent music companies across Europe. These businesses, including self-releasing artists, account for 80% of new releases and sector employment. The organisation’s stated mission is to grow the independent sector sustainably, return more value to artists, promote diversity and entrepreneurship, improve political access, inspire change and increase access to finance.
